      Le processus a pris 8 semaines. J'ai passé un entretien chez Google en juil. 2011

      Entretien

      Not at all complaining about NOT getting hired. But I am trying to figure out how they come to a conclusion based on the interview experience. Here are the details from my experience: 1:1 on phone was fine. 6 weeks later get an email saying I have an on-site interview. Scheduled that. Nervous as heck, right, bc this is Google? But the interview process was incomprehensible. They asked me (through 4 interviews) to design like 6 studies all the mean time typing away with their head buried in their computer typing madly. (They should know that is completely inhibiting of a fluid conversation.) I was asking myself if this is how they conduct research, which is against fundamental practices. That is it. Nothing on data analysis, presentation, data collection, or any other skills that also make up the job. That baffles me because they were sending the message that I can only handle one sole responsibility: designing studies. I hope after this much I invested in my career (edu + experience) I would be considered to have more traits. I work at a substantial company equivalent to Google and have received the utmost top reviews repeatedly and they had no way to figure this out? Also, this was a big red flag - I never met with a hiring manager. I got 5 minutes at the end of each session to ask questions (with one interviewer literally saying "I guess I promised you some time to ask me questions"). On some level, I felt they failed me and I dont know if I would feel comfortable working there when they sent a message that they are above me (by not speaking to a manager, not making eye contact, not explaining the job) and that I possess only one trait. Please interpret this solely as an account of my experience and nothing more. I feel that a company like Google would have a more sophisticated hiring process that gets at the person, which this failed to do. It actually made me fall in love again with my current position - so I got something out of it!!

      J'ai postulé en ligne. J'ai passé un entretien chez Google (Seattle, WA) en août 2025

      Entretien

      Coding interviews, research interviews, job talks, and behavioral interviews. The behavioral interviews were standard, designed to assess cultural fit, teamwork, and professional conduct. The coding assessments followed the standard LeetCode style, focusing on problem-solving and algorithmic thinking on whiteboard. Interviews are quite professional and warm. They asked questions based on my research.
